Understanding Integrated Pest Management

Integrated Pest Management is a comprehensive, ecosystem-based strategy that focuses on long-term prevention and control of pest problems through a combination of techniques. Key Components of IPM

  • Thorough inspection and monitoring
  • Identification of pest species and behavior patterns
  • Prevention through habitat modification
  • Use of natural predators and biological controls
  • Environmental modifications

Traditional Chemical Treatments: Benefits and Drawbacks

Chemical pesticides have been widely used throughout the Central Business District and residential areas. While they can provide quick results, they often come with significant drawbacks:

Advantages of Chemical Treatments

  • Rapid pest elimination
  • Widely available solutions
  • Immediate visible results

Disadvantages of Chemical Treatments

  • Potential health risks
  • Environmental impact
  • Pest resistance development
  • Need for frequent reapplication
